French Film
"Could it be that French is the true language of love?"
Originally released in 2008. French Film is a romance/comedy film. directed by Jackie Oudney. At just 87 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Éric Cantona, Hugh Bonneville, and Adrian Annis
Synopsis
Jed prepares to interview French cineaste and self-appointed expert on the nature of love - Thierry Grimandi. The worldly and somewhat jaded Jed is dead-set on dismissing the auteur's musings as pompous and, well French, until his own relationship with Cheryl starts to fall apart and he is forced to re-evaluate the illusive subject. Soon everyone is talking about love: his relationship counsellor, drinking buddy Marcus and Marcus' girlfriend Sophie Beginnings, endings, tricks...could the French be on to something?
